A drawing contained 5 circles, 8 triangles, and 6 squares. What is the ratio of circles to squares?

5:14

5:8

6:5

5:6

A drawing contained 5 circles and 8 squares. What is the ratio of the number of squares to the number of circles?

8:13

13:8

5:8

8:5

A fruit salad contains 3 bananas, 4 apples, 2 peaches, and 15 strawberries. What is the ratio of strawberries to bananas in the fruit salad?

1:5

3:5

5:1

5:8

A recipe for ice cream uses 6 cups of sugar and 8 cups of milk. Which choice shows the ratio of sugar to milk?

3:7

7:3

3:4

4:3

A flower arrangement consists of 8 tulips, 4 roses, 3 daisies, and 5 carnations. What is the ratio of all of the flowers to tulips?

5:2

2:5

8:5

5:8

Karina has 3 markers, 6 colored pencils, 3 highlighters, and 4 pens. What is the ratio of colored pencils and pens to markers and highlighters?

8:3

5:3

3:8

3:5
